Prepare an 8 × 8 baking dish lined with parchment paper. Set aside.
Add all ingredients for the peanut butter crispy layer to a food processor and process until the cereal is broken down into small pieces and everything is well combined, taking care to not over process.
Transfer the mixture to the prepared baking dish and spread it evenly on the bottom of the dish. Place an extra piece of parchment paper on top of the peanut butter crispy mixture and press it down very tight and compact. Set aside.
For the caramel layer:
Add all ingredients for the caramel layer to a food processor and process until the dates are broken down into small pieces and everything is well combined.
Transfer the mixture to the baking dish and spread it evenly over the top of the peanut butter crispy layer.
For the chocolate topping:
Add all ingredients for the chocolate topping to a small saucepan and melt on lowest heat, stirring until it is completely melted and smooth, taking care to not let it burn.
Pour the chocolate topping evenly over the top of the caramel layer.
Place the baking dish in the freezer overnight, or until the squares are firm.
Remove the baking dish from the freezer and cut it into 16 squares or 8 large bars.

Storage Notes:
Chill Time: For the perfect firm texture, let the bars chill in the freezer for a few hours, or overnight if you can resist!
Fridge: Store your rice krispie squares in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week. They’ll stay fresh and chewy—just grab one whenever you need a sweet pick-me-up.
Freezer: These bars are freezer-friendly! Pop them in an airtight container or freezer bag for up to 3 months. Perfect for making a batch ahead of time and having a caramel treat ready to go whenever the craving strikes.
Stay Chill: These squares will get soft if left out at room temperature, so be sure to keep them chilled for the best texture.
